01 / The everyday vesselChalk
A hand-built stoneware vessel with a soft chalk glaze and fine horizontal throwing lines. Approximately 18 cm tall. A place for cut branches, wooden spoons, or nothing at all.
02 / The long-neck bottleTerracotta
A sculptural bottle in warm iron-rich clay, left mostly unglazed to keep the surface honest. Approximately 25 cm tall. Made in a small edition of twelve.
03 / The pouring jugAsh
A generous, low jug with a hand-pulled handle and an earthy ash glaze. Approximately 16 cm tall. Designed to move easily from kitchen shelf to table.
